Data Manager for Development

Hi,

We are exploring possible new development department staffing structures that would provide better data management/list building support for our Development campaign managers. Do any of you have a departmental structure in which there is a single departmental manager who is responsible for Tessitura set-up and supervising data management and list building, and who oversees financial reconciliation and reporting? Or do you have a shared position with other departments? If so, we'd really appreciate hearing about how you manage and staff this. Thanks for any and all insight you can offer!

  • Hi Charlotte,
     
    At The Playhouse, I hold the power user position within the Development department; my title is Development Operations Mgr.
     
    I set up new users/solicitors within our dept's log in groups, update systems tables related to devo's tasks, configure new funds/campaigns/appeals, enter contributions/adjustments and generate acknowledgements, monitor the credit card server as it relates to Devo charges, create lists and extractions for Devo merge documents, manage membership renewals/annual fund, coordinate Telefunding lists for our in-house callers, maintain the data integrity of the donor records, coordinate e-communications (WordFly) for our dept., facilitate the FY reconciliation processes between Devo and the Finance dept, and generate ad-hoc reports.  In addition, I oversee the dept's expense budget and supervise an assistant and interns.
     
    Marketing and Box Office have their own power users and we all are backed up by our IT staff.  We are also in constant communication with each other because many of our projects cross-connect.
     
    Like Mike at City Center, I believe it's important to have consistency in contribution entry--following a donation through to membership renewals/adjustments and then on to acknowledgements--because there are often exceptions that need to be implemented along the way.  The rest of the Devo team updates constituent contact information related to their portfolios, manage their solicitation records, update activity records ...and any other information gathered from cultivation and research.
